The following only applies if you, or someone helping you, are very comfortable troubleshooting live 120/240 vac power.
Next time you lose power, disconnect your power cord FROM THE BACK of the trailer (leaving it plugged into the pedestal). Using a volt meter verify you have or do not have 120/240 vac at that end of the cord. That should prove the problem is either from the cord back to the pedestal (i.e. not the trailer) or in the trailer itself. See link below.
